What is a Kanban Board?

A Kanban board is a visual tool that helps teams track and manage work through various stages of a workflow. The board is divided into columns, with each column representing a stage in the process, such as "To Do," "In Progress," and "Completed." Tasks are represented by cards that move from one column to the next as work progresses. This visual approach helps teams manage work efficiently, ensure transparency, and identify bottlenecks in the workflow.

Best Practices for Using a Kanban Board

To get the most out of your free online Kanban board, consider the following best practices:

  • Limit Work in Progress (WIP): One of the core principles of Kanban is limiting the number of tasks that are being worked on at any given time. This helps prevent overloading team members and ensures that tasks are completed before new ones are started.
  • Prioritize Tasks: Ensure that the most important tasks are placed at the top of the board or in a designated priority column. This ensures that the team focuses on the highest-value work first.
  • Regularly Update the Board: Keep the board updated with the latest task status and information. This helps everyone stay informed and ensures that the board accurately reflects the current state of the project.
  • Review the Board Periodically: Hold regular reviews of the Kanban board to evaluate progress, identify potential issues, and adjust workflows as needed. This helps keep the project on track and allows for continuous improvement.
  • Communicate Effectively: Use the Kanban board as a tool for communication within the team. Encourage team members to comment on task cards, share feedback, and keep everyone updated on their progress.
